Marc Jacobs Launches E-Commerce Site

Marc Jacobs has overhauled its online presence, launching its first e-commerce site at www.marcjacobs.com. The new e-commerce site has a whimsical style that's clear from the landing page which features an attractive smiling avatar beckoning you in. The site, which combines illustration, photography and video was created by digital commerce agency CREATETHE GROUP, which has worked with Marc Jacobs since 2004. The website is designed to represent a physical Marc Jacobs store and has also been optimized for the iPhone and iPad. The brand decided to stock the virtual store with a small, curated selection of items picked by Marc Jacobs executives rather than everything Marc all at once. One of the most interesting parts of the site is the "world of Marc Jacobs" section which features the latest news, runway videos, ads but also video profiles of some of the many employees of the brand (employees also appear as avatars on the site, decked out in Marc Jacobs attire).
